  • Bobby 'Blue' Bland     (Singer, songwriter)
    • Find-A-Grave Memorial for Bobby 'Blue' Bland<1>
    • He was born in Rosemark (TN) on January 27, 1930 (a Monday) and died in Memphis (TN) on June 23, 2013 (a Sunday).
    • Rosemark is located in Shelby County and is 7 miles [11.3 km] to the east of Wilkinsville (which is located in Tipton County).
    • Memphis is located in Shelby County and is 19 miles [30.6 km] to the southwest of Wilkinsville (which is located in Tipton County).
    • At the time of his death, he was 83.
    • He is buried at Memorial Park Cemetery, located 20 miles [32.2 km] to the south of Wilkinsville. The cemetery is located in Shelby County, Tennessee.

  • Isaac Hayes     (Singer, musician, composer, actor)
    • Full name: Isaac Lee Hayes, Jr.
    • Find-A-Grave Memorial for Isaac Hayes<1>
    • He was born in Covington (TN) on August 20, 1942 (a Thursday) and died in Memphis (TN) on August 10, 2008 (a Sunday).
    • Covington is located 17 miles [27.4 km] to the northeast of Wilkinsville. Both communities are located in Tipton County.
    • Memphis is located in Shelby County and is 19 miles [30.6 km] to the southwest of Wilkinsville (which is located in Tipton County).
    • At the time of his death, he was 66.
    • He is buried at Memorial Park Cemetery, located 20 miles [32.2 km] to the south of Wilkinsville. The cemetery is located in Shelby County, Tennessee.
